Egg Curry (अंडा करी )

Ingredients :


6 .........................boiled eggs ( remove the shells  and cut in half )
2 ........................onions ( 1 chopped + 1 sliced )
2 .......................tomatoes ( finely chopped )
fistful ..................coriander leaves
2 to 3 tbsp...........fresh grated coconut
5 to 6 ..................garlic cloves
2 to 3 ....................green chillies
1 tsp.......................coriander seeds
1 tsp........................fennel seeds
1/2 tsp...................pepper
1/2tsp....................cumin seeds
2 ............................cloves
1/2 inch..................cinnamon
1 tsp....................chilly powder
1/2 tsp................turmeric powder
4 tbsp...................oil
salt




Method :


Heat a tbsp of oil and add all dry seeds and stir fry for 2 mintues.

Now add  garlic and sliced onions and saute till golden.

Add grated coconut and again stir for 5 minutes.

Grind this along with coriander leaves and green chillies with very little water.

Now in a non stick pan add remaining oil and saute onions till translucent.

Now add chopped tomtoes and cook till oil separates.

Finally add ground masala and all other powder along with salt .

Dilute the gravy with water if needed.

When the gravy starts boiling add boiled egg halves and cook further for 2 mintues.

Let the eggs get properly coated with gravy.

Serve hot with rotis or plain rice.

Makhane ki Sabji

Makhane or the popped lotus seeds as they are known are very delicious . They can be used in sweet as well as savoury dished .  You can make Makhane kheer as well which is equally mouth watering . Will certainly try to the recipe in future. As of now lets enjoy the Makhane sabji which is one yummy preparation .

Ingrediets :

100 gms - Makhane
2 - finely chopped onions
2 - finely chopped tomatoes
2 tsp - ginger garlic paste
1 tsp - garam masala
2 cups - milk
10- 12 -  cashews ground to paste
1/2 cup - fresh malai or khoya
2 tsp - chilli powder
1 tsp - turmeric powder
salt
sugar
ghee



Method :

Heat 1 tbsp ghee and stir fry the makhanas in them till they become crisp and light pink.
Again heat 2 to 3 tbsp ghee and stir fry onions till they are golden.
Add ginger garlic paste and cook for 5 to 10 minutes.
Add tomatoes and cook till the ghee starts separating.
Add makhanas and mix well.
Then add garam masala, salt , sugar and milk and cook for 10 minutes.
Add the cashew paste and malai and cook for 5 more minutes.
Garnish with coriande leaves.
